This is of St Peter, a rugged fisherman, as Jesus tells him that he will build ('on this rock'), his worldwide church; the churches illustrated are real churches, from Peter's own house-church at the bottom to 20th-century creations at the top, with the Vatican church, dedicated to Peter's memory, the largest of these, roughly central.
